April 9, 2009 Dear Mr. ###:
Thank you for contacting American Airlines Customer Relations. I am pleased to respond to your concerns.

Please accept my apology for the difficulties you encountered when you traveled with us. From your description of what happened it certainly sounds as if the entire experience was frustrating. I am truly sorry we didn't provide the level of service you expect and deserve.

We wish we had it in our power to guarantee that planes would always arrive on time and that delays and cancellations just wouldn't happen. Unhappily, we don't -- but what we can and should do is make every attempt to minimize the inconvenience for our customers whenever we do encounter operational problems. I am sorry that we didn't do a better job of making the situation a little less trying.

The fact remains that our schedules are not guaranteed and are subject to change without notice. We have the authority and the responsibility to make changes to our schedules to resolve problems caused by weather, flight conditions, mechanical difficulties or other operational challenges. Accordingly, we cannot assume financial responsibility for our customers' personal time lost or for out-of-pocket expenses when extenuating circumstances prevent us from operating as planned. I am sorry.

However, because we'd like to encourage you to fly with us again soon, I've credited 15,000 bonus miles to your AAdvantage® account. You can see this activity via aa.com/aadvantage (you must log in with your account number).
Mr. ###, I hope you are persuaded to think a little more favorably of us. We value you as a customer and are eager to restore your confidence. Please give us another opportunity to serve you -- we know your time is valuable and we'll do our very best to get you to your destination as planned.
